Subject: Quickstore 4.2 — bloom filter now fronts the KV layer

Plugin authors: starting with this release, Quickstore places a bloom filter ahead of the key-value store. Negative lookups return faster; false positives fall through safely. No API changes are required on your side. Verify your plugin against the staging build referenced below.

session token of fahif-tadup = htk3_9c7

**Q: Why did Squatternet flag a package our customer actually wanted?**

Squatternet scores packages by name similarity to popular registries, so legit forks with close names (like `fastparse2`) sometimes trip the threshold. Tell the customer it's a warning, not a block — they can allowlist the package in their Squatternet dashboard under Policy Exceptions. If the same false positive keeps coming up across accounts, we'll tune the model. Send recurring cases to the scanner team for review.

alerts address for fajeg-baduf: druael@torvahq.corp

Ticket: Migration vault locked mid-release. Hey — the Ledgerline zero-downtime migration tool locked its credentials vault after three bad attempts during tonight's expand-contract run on Ordershade. Schema changes are half-applied but safe; traffic is fine. To resume the contract phase before the morning window, unlock the vault with the recovery passphrase below.

strongbox words: sorir-belvan-rusix-ulays-ralmir-praix-eliir-tamax-praael-druael-julir-tamius-jorir